The U.S. Consulate General in Cape Town seeks an Administrative Clerk (Community Grants) in the Executive Section (Exec).  Applicants must have ALL the following requirements:
  1. Education: Successful completion of Grade 12 (Matric) is required.
  2. Experience: Two years work experience in administration or clerical positions is required.        
  3. Language: English level IV in reading, writing and speaking is required. Level III in isiZulu writing/reading/speaking are required.
  4. Knowledge: Knowledge of Non Government Organization (NGO) work community development and their challenges in South Africa is required.
  5. Skills and Abilities: 
  • Excellent computer skills and knowledge of Microsoft Office applications, especially Outlook, Word and Excel is required.  (This will be tested).
  • Ability to work for multiple people, juggling schedules and prioritizing is required.
  • Ability to provide unofficial translation for Coordinators during workshop presentations and meetings, and handling applicant inquiries and questions is required.
  • Ability to make presentations to groups is required.
  • Good judgment in assessing and recommending projects is required.
  • Ability to develop and maintain a network of working level outside contacts; excellent drafting, organizational and time management skills is required.
  • Excellent interpersonal skills are required.
